Congress leader among five killed in accidents

NAHAN : During past twenty four hours five persons including a senior Congress leader of Sirmour district have been killed in two separate accidents.

A car [HP 16A – 3000] on way to Dhamander village, which was returning from Badu meeting of Chief Minister Virbhadra Singh fell into a deep gorge near Sheelabag on the Rajgarh-Neri Pul-Pulbahal road last night in which three persons Gyan Singh Verma, Senior Vice President of Sirmour Dictrict Congress Committee and a resident of Dhamander village, Sahi Ram Verma and Jai Ram Verma, both resident of Tali Bhujjal village under Rajgarh Sub Division were killed on the spot.

They were rushed to Rajgarh Hospital but could not survive. Mr Gangu Ram Musafir, Speaker Himachal Pradesh Vidhan Sabha in his condolence message received here this evening has expressed his deep grief on the deaths and said that with the demise of Gyan Singh Verma, Sirmour district has lost a leading social worker and politician of a stature.

In another accident which took place last night at Bhoop Pur [Paonta] a Truck [HR 37-1033] crushed a Motorcycle under its tyres and killed on the spot two persons riding on the motorcycle including one Ayub Khan rider of the bike and a resident of Paonta area.

Paonta Police has arrested driver of the truck, Ishwer Chand and a case has been registered in this regard.
